Team fault lines why inclusiveness is key for effective workplace diversity tuesday, 22 march 2016 features biological law tells us that diverse systems are the most adaptive because complex organisms are more likely to evolve and survive. For instance, when all of the women in a group are over 60 years old and all of the men are under 30, the sex and age faultlines align and form a single, stronger faultline.
